Scrabble, our Border Terrier puppy monster.

Here's Scrabble, our nine week old Border Terrier in a variety of poses. Note the last one: I went for a shower, returned, and discovered her eating the christmas decorations

Amazing that we can tell she has already grown in a week, and can no longer charge through the stairgate. She's doing fairly well in that she knows 'Sit', and is starting to nip a bit less fiercely. As hard as it is, we couldn't imagine her not being here now
